Azerbaijan increases purchase of Shah Deniz's gas

Azerbaijan, Baku, July 30 / Trend /

In January-June, Azerbaijan received about 1.1 billion cubic meters of gas from gas condensate field Shah Deniz compared to about 763.6 million cubic meters over the same period in 2009, SOCAR reported.

About 294.2 million cubic meters of the total amount of gas received in January-June fall to SOCAR in the project of Shah Deniz and the rest - 769.5 million cubic meters of gas from the field was bought by SOCAR.

The contract to develop the offshore Shah Deniz field was signed June 4, 1996. Participants to the agreement are: BP (operator) - 25.5 percent, Statoil Hydro - 25.5 percent, NICO - 10 percent, Total - 10 percent, LukAgip - 10 percent, TPAO - 9 percent, SOCAR-10 percent.

Now gas is transported to Georgia and Turkey via the South Caucasus gas pipeline.

It is expected to receive 7.84 billion cubic meters in the field this year, peak production forecasted at over 8.6-9 billion cubic meters. It is planned that in the second stage of field development, gas production can be brought up to 20 billion cubic meters a year.
